Structure and How It Works
These worksheets typically employ a structured format to guide learners through the subtraction process. The layout generally includes a visual representation of the two-digit numbers involved in the subtraction problem. Core Exercises: The initial section usually displays the minuend (the number from which another is subtracted) represented by base ten blocks. This is followed by a clearly presented subtraction problem, alongside a visual representation of the subtrahend (the number being subtracted). Learners are then guided to cross out or remove blocks representing the subtrahend from the minuend. This visual process allows students to directly see the physical removal of quantities. Interactive Elements: Many worksheets incorporate interactive elements, such as drawing lines to cross out blocks or filling in blanks to show the remaining number of tens and ones. Some also include word problems that require students to first translate the problem into a numerical equation and then solve it using the base ten block method. Advanced worksheets might introduce regrouping concepts, where students learn to decompose a ten block into ten ones to facilitate subtraction in the ones place.
Tips and Complementary Resources
To maximize the effectiveness of these worksheets, it is essential to integrate them strategically into the learning routine. Daily Practice Tips: Short, focused sessions are generally more productive than long, infrequent ones. Consider dedicating 15-20 minutes each day to working through a few problems. It is beneficial to start with simpler problems and gradually increase the difficulty as the learner gains confidence. Encouraging students to verbally explain their thought process as they work through each problem can also solidify their understanding. Pairing with Other Resources: While the worksheets provide a visual aid, supplementing them with physical base ten blocks can enhance the learning experience. Physical blocks offer a tactile experience that further reinforces the concept of place value and regrouping.
